Gen Urobuchi Talks About Kamen Rider Gaim in the Latest Hyper Hobby Magazine Issue


Because Kamen Rider Gaim's designs kinda looked ridiculous, fans wondered if the show will end up having a ridiculous plot. In the latest issue of Hyper Hobby magazine, series head writer Gen Urobuchi (Puella Magi Madoka Magica, Fate/Zero) gives us a good overview about the series.


Unlike its predecessors, Kamen Rider Gaim's storytelling will be similar to the older Heisei Kamen Rider shows with the show breaking the habit of having obvious two-part episodes. In short, the style will be similar to Kamen Rider Kuuga-555. When it comes to the characters, he hopes htat he can portray a more dramatic take on the characters and situations not seen since the early Heisei Kamen Rider shows.


As for the characters, he describes Mitsuzane/Ryugen as a thoughtful character who doesn't wish to be a burden on anyone else. He also mentions that Kaito/Balon is an argumentative and quick to anger despite having a pure heart. As for Ryugen's brother, Takatora/Zangetsu, he describes him as the "Ouja" of the series. For those who are not aware on who is Ouja, he is from Kamen Rider Ryuki and he is the crazy, homicidal character with the most Rider kills in the show.


The interview also revealed why the show is starting a bit late. It is to allow a short anniversary of the Heisei era so that Kamen Rider Gaim can truly shine on its own. Lastly, he mentions how he ended up working on Kamen Rider. It is thanks to voice actor Tomokazu Sugita (JoJo's Bizarre Adventure, Gintama) who voiced Kivat in Kamen Rider Kiva and working on the show is a personal dream come true for him.
